20:10:08:12Refund during service.

When the subscriber has paid bills for service for 12 consecutive months without having service disconnected for nonpayment and without receiving three or more disconnection notices, the telecommunications company shall promptly and automatically refund the deposit plus accrued interest to the customer in the form of cash or credit to the subscriber's bill. The subscriber shall choose the form of the refund.

Source: SL 1975, ch 16, § 1; 12 SDR 85, effective November 24, 1985; 12 SDR 155, 12 SDR 155, effective July 1, 1986.
